Radio Bilingüe to Broadcast Specials from Storied Tejano Conjunto Festival in San Antonio

Radio Bilingüe heads to San Antonio next week to produce and broadcast extended specials from the 37th Annual Tejano Conjunto Festival in collaboration with the festival’s organizers, the Guadalupe Cultural Arts Center, and with support from the National Endowment for the Arts.

Celebrate the Sounds of California in San Francisco’s Bayview on Sunday, April 29.

The Alliance for California Traditional Arts (ACTA) invites you to a lively afternoon of music and conversations from the San Francisco Bay Area’s African-American, Vietnamese, Kurdish, and Chicano communities.

Dreamer Stories Radio Fellowship

(Español) Radio Bilingüe is taking applications from enthusiastic reporters or students for a six-month paid fellowship to cover immigration and immigrant integration, with special emphasis on the debate around the DACA crisis and the Dream Act.
